How does trimmer bump feed work?

Trimmer bump feed works by allowing the cutter to control the feed of line on the trimmer head. When the cutter depresses the knob or head, it causes the trimmer head to rotate, thereby allowing more line to come out of the head.

The line then comes out through the trimmer head slots, ready for use. Depending on the particular trimmer model, the user may need to tap or bump the head several times to get enough line out for trimming.

By tapping the head, the cutter is able to control more precisely the amount of line that is released, ensuring a more consistent trimming experience.

Why is my Black and Decker not feeding line?

There could be a few reasons why your Black and Decker is not feeding line. The most common cause of this problem is when the line starts to get tangled inside the spool, preventing it from feeding properly.

Another possible reason your black and Decker isn’t feeding line could be that the line has become worn and frayed. If this is the case, it may not be able to pass through the feeder tube correctly. Additionally, if dirt and debris have built up inside the feeder tube and/or spool, this can also prevent line from being fed properly.

Lastly, if the spool is empty or there is not enough line coming from the spool, it may cause the line not to be fed. In this case, you would need to refill the spool with fresh line. To make sure your Black and Decker feeds line properly, always make sure the entire spool is filled with line and that it is free from tangles.

Additionally, it is a good idea to inspect the line for any signs of wear and tear, and replace it if necessary.

Is bump feed or auto feed better?

When it comes to deciding between a bump feed and an auto feed for a trimmer, there is no single answer as to which one is ‘better. ‘ The choice will depend on an individual’s preferences, the type of trimmer they own, the terrain they have to trim and their budget.

Bump feed trimmers are a tried and true design and are commonly found on consumer-grade string trimmers. Bump feed trimmers require the operator to take their finger off the power and tap the head of the trimmer against the ground to get fresh line out of the spool.

This can be labor-intensive if the trimming task is large.

Auto feed trimmers are usually more expensive than bump feed trimmers. They offer the convenience of auto-feeding with no manual manipulation required. This convenience comes at a premium, however, as the auto feed mechanism can be prone to jamming and malfunctions.

Ultimately, to decide what’s best for you, it’s important to consider the above-mentioned details. Both types of trimmers are available in a variety of sizes, shapes, and styles to suit different terrains, budgets, and preferences.

Consider your needs before making your choice in order to find the best match.

What size line does my trimmer use?

The size of line that your trimmer uses will depend on the model you have. Some trimmers use 0.080 inch line, some use 0.095 inch line, and some even use 0.105 inch line. To determine the size of line your trimmer uses, you will need to check the manual that came with it.

There should be a section that specifies the type of line that should be used in the trimmer. If you have lost the manual, you can often look up the manufacturer’s website and look up the model of your trimmer to find the specifics on the size of line needed.

What is the cause of trimmer head not spinning?

The cause of a trimmer head not spinning can have multiple factors, but the most likely cause is an issue with the power source. This could be caused by a faulty spark plug, a clogged air filter, or low fuel.

If the fuel mixture is incorrect, the spark plug can become fouled with carbon deposits and cause an inability to start. A clogged air filter can also prevent an adequate flow of air to the engine, resulting in weakened ignition performance and the trimmer head not spinning.

In some cases, an underlying mechanical issue can cause a trimmer head to not spin. This can include worn down parts or a seized bearing or pulley inside the trimmer head assembly that prevents it from spinning properly.

For this type of issue, it is recommended to refer to the trimmer’s maintenance and repair manual or contact certified service personnel.
